Fair Grounds, Race 9
The Letellier Stakes
Saturday’s late pick four sequence at Fair Grounds is a very interesting one and it kicks off with the $60,000 Letellier Stakes for two-year-old fillies sprinting six furlongs on the main track.
In her most recent start, Assets of War earned a Performance Figure of 89 even though she was soundly defeated in an entry-level allowance race at Churchill Downs. The winner Pure Fun’s final time of that race was a sparkling 1.34.91. On the very same day at Churchill, the promising colt Gulfport won a similarly-paced entry-level allowance in a final time just over a full second slower. Pure Fun’s final time seemed almost unbelievable, but she quickly backed it up when she shipped across the country, winning the Grade 1 Hollywood Starlet Stakes in scintillating fashion at 6/1 odds on just two weeks’ rest.
Not only is Assets of War competitive on Performance Figures, but the pace dynamics are absolutely perfect for her running style. Five different horses in this race are speedy, front-end types, a pace meltdown seems almost inevitable and Assets of War is the closer most likely to benefit.
For exotic wagering purposes, neither of the expected favorites Coastal Sunrise and Brotherhood Singer should be tossed out. Brotherhood Singer should also benefit from the pace dynamics and is the main danger to Assets of War. Coastal Sunrise will undoubtedly by hindered by the pace pressure, but she should prove the speediest of them all and her most recent Performance Figure of 93 is four points faster than Assets of War.
The most attractive exotic wagering propositions available are the pick 3 and pick 4. In race #11 at Fair Grounds, first-time starter Stourbridge Lion is 9/2 on the morning line in a maiden special weight race for trainer Steve Asmussen. Stourbridge Lion fetched $560,000 at public auction after an impressive 20.40 seconds quarter mile over the polytrack at Keeneland. His sire is champion sprinter Speightstown and his dam won her racing debut in wire-to-wire fashion at 4.5 furlongs. This potentially speedy colt can be singled in the Pick 3 and Pick 4 sequences that start with Assets of War’s race.
